Paula Deen's Mac and Cheese

ingredients
- 3⁄4 lb elbow macaroni
- 3 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ese (10 oz.)
- 3 large eggs
- 1⁄2 cup sour cream
- 1 cup milk
- 4 teaspoons unsalted butter, cut into small pieces
- salt
directions
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
- Lightly butter an 8x12" baking dish.
- In a pot of boiling salted water, cook the macaroni until al dente. Drain, transfer to a bowl.
- Add two cups of the cheese and toss until melted.
- In another bowl, whisk the eggs with the sour cream.
- Add the milk, butter, and 1/2 teaspoons salt.
- Stir the mixture into the macaroni and pour it into the prepared baking dish.
- Sprinkle the remaining cheese on top.
- Bake for 35 minutes, until bubbling and cheese is melted.
- Let the macaroni and cheese stand for 15 minutes before serving.
